Solution : |x+3| =7
or x= -10 or x=4

Explanation:
•You are basically looking for 2 values of X
•First X will be to the left of -3
•Second X will be to the right of -3
•Both X’s will be 7 units away from -3, if you do this correctly you will find that x to the left is equal to -10 and x to the right is equal to 4

You can develop the absolute value equation as follows:
X=-3 -7
Or
X=-3+7

Add 3 to both sides of the equation to get :
X+3=7
X+3=-7

This fits the basic definition of an absolute value equation that states if |x|=y , then x=y or x=-y
